Transaction 9de408a1625b46563a144fff23110926fac3eb8582c6ea71aae0ab10594c12d7
1 Input
1 Output
-
9de408a1625b46563a144fff23110926fac3eb8582c6ea71aae0ab10594c12d7:0
- value
- 642288
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c94805af57eb334bbe7c25cd255211c0e3bcd00 OP_EQUAL
- address
- 3QiY6wcHY54Hd323JyD5XegFc6p6DVP463